Grok 4.20 0309 v2

Language Model

A high-performance reasoning language model from xAI, listed on Artificial Analysis, that supports text and image input with a 2M token context window. Notable for fast inference speed and strong intelligence ranking among comparable models.

Claude Sonnet 4.6

Language Model

Anthropic's Claude Sonnet 4.6 is a high-performance large language model offering an optimal balance of intelligence, speed, and cost for enterprise AI workflows, coding assistance, and complex reasoning tasks.

Grok 4.20 0309 v2 - Pros & Cons

Pros

  • βœ“2M token context window is substantially larger than most competing reasoning models, enabling whole-codebase or whole-book analysis
  • βœ“Multimodal support accepts both text and image inputs in a single request
  • βœ“Positioned in the 'most attractive quadrant' of price-vs-intelligence on the Artificial Analysis chart, indicating strong value relative to peers
  • βœ“Fast output speed measured in tokens-per-second sustained after first chunk, suitable for latency-sensitive streaming UIs
  • βœ“Evaluated against 10 rigorous benchmarks including Humanity's Last Exam, GPQA Diamond, and SciCode for transparent quality reporting
  • βœ“Cached input pricing at ~$0.75/M tokens reduces costs for repeated long-context prompts by roughly 75% versus standard input rates

Cons

  • βœ—Pricing is per-token only β€” no flat-rate or subscription tier for individual users
  • βœ—Smaller third-party provider ecosystem compared to OpenAI or Anthropic, limiting failover and routing options
  • βœ—As a reasoning model, latency to first token can be higher than non-reasoning peers due to internal chain-of-thought
  • βœ—Documentation and SDK maturity lag behind GPT and Claude, requiring more integration work
  • βœ—Output speed and price metrics rely on first-party API median; real-world variance across providers can be significant

Claude Sonnet 4.6 - Pros & Cons

Pros

  • βœ“Strong balance of speed, intelligence, and costβ€”outperforms many competitors at its price point
  • βœ“200K context window handles large documents and extended conversations without truncation
  • βœ“Excellent coding performance, particularly for agentic multi-step software engineering tasks
  • βœ“Available across multiple cloud platforms (Anthropic API, Vertex AI, Bedrock) for deployment flexibility
  • βœ“Prompt caching and batch API provide meaningful cost savings for production workloads
  • βœ“Strong safety alignment reduces risk of harmful or hallucinated outputs in enterprise settings
  • βœ“Vision capabilities allow multimodal input without needing a separate model

Cons

  • βœ—Output token limits (default 8,192) may require configuration for very long generation tasks
  • βœ—Per-token pricing is higher than open-source alternatives like Llama 3.1 when self-hosted
  • βœ—Not the most capable model in Anthropic's lineupβ€”Opus 4.6 outperforms on the hardest reasoning tasks
  • βœ—Fine-tuning options are more limited compared to open-weight models
  • βœ—Rate limits on free and lower-tier plans can be restrictive for heavy prototyping
  • βœ—Image input onlyβ€”does not support video or audio modalities natively
